Salman Khan recently tasted the sweet success of Tiger Zinda Hai at the box office, breaking several records at a time. Not wasting much time, the Sultan of Bollywood kick-started the prep of his next film Race 3, the third installment of popular Race franchise. However, a shocking incident made Salman Khan leave the sets of Race 3 and head back home. The 52-year-old Dabangg Khan received death threats by a set of people who barged into Goregaon film city where the cast was shooting. Jodhpur-based gangster Lawrence Bishnoi sent three men with death threats to the actor owing to his 1998 blackbuck poaching case.

Also, a group of vandals were sent to destroy the sets of Race 3. Bishnoi issued the threat saying, “Salman Khan will be killed here, in Jodhpur... Then he will come to know about our real identity.” The gangster hailing from Rajasthan apparantly worships black bucks. Salman was safely escorted to his Galaxy Apartments and told to stay low key.

A source told Mumbai Mirror, “The police arrived at the Race 3 set in Film City and told Salman and producer Ramesh Taurani that the shoot had to be stopped immediately as the actor needed to head home as soon as possible. Salman was escorted in another car by six cops, while his own car was driven back to his residence by another group of cops.”

The superstar actor has now been advised to stay off the social media and avoid posting his whereabouts on it. As we know how much Salman likes to take a ride on his Being Human cycles, but even that has been asked to avoid. A steamy dance sequence with the leading lady Jacqueline Fernandez was scheduled to take place over the next two day, which is most likely to get postponed due to aforementioned situation. Race 3 is directed by Remo D’souza with Anil Kapoor, Bobby Deol, Saqib Saleem and Daisy Shah forming a strong supporting cast.
